I am not sure you can totally trust the trade logs. For example (from what I observed in the past on a couple of occasions), if his entry software isn't functioning properly and causes big slippage or a loss he will record it like an ideal entry occurred instead - I guess to show what he thinks should have happened. I am just more comfortable recording your results as they actually happened, even with screw-ups. Even if he no longer does that, my view is tainted. So my preference would be for him to not publish his trade results at all. But overall I do think he is trading better than before - ringing the resister and not going for the huge winners.

Yeah I like Jam, but I don't feel he is a good trader - one reason being he changes his system too much . Actually I really liked the methodology Jam used when I signed up years ago where he used dynamic support and resistance zones, small size renko bars, clear Q filter signals, etc. I wish he never went away from that. Every time I come back to his room for a visit, the charts and system have changed again. Wish he wouldn't do that.
